Position Summary

 The Senior Enterprise Systems Engineer is responsible for designing, implementing, securing, and maintaining enterprise-level systems, applications, services, and cloud platforms. This role proactively and reactively defends against security threats, troubleshoots and resolves complex technical issues, investigates and mitigates security incidents, and ensures the reliability, security, and performance of enterprise platforms. The engineer also supports ongoing modernization initiatives and collaborates with cross-functional teams to deliver stable and scalable technology services. This role requires a strategic thinker with deep hands-on technical expertise in IT infrastructure, security operations, automation, and cloud security. This role also requires individuals who are trustworthy, reliable, and uphold strict ethical standards in all professional dealings. Flexibility to work non-standard hours and participate in on-call rotation is required.

 

Key Responsibilities

  • Designs, implements, and optimizes enterprise IT infrastructure services across on-premises and cloud environments, including core identity, platform, and systems management services

  • Oversees implementation, management, and optimization of enterprise security and monitoring tools and systems (e.g. antivirus, EDR, ITDR, and FIM platforms)

  • Oversees implementation, manages, and enhances privileged access management (PAM) system

  • Monitors, detects, and responds to security threats, leading incident response efforts, from detection to resolution and post-incident reviews

  • Conducts regular audits and assessments of server security and application, system, and data access controls, vulnerability management, and implements security best practices and recommendations, to ensure compliance with security policies and standards, and to protect the firm's data and assets

  • Plans and implements system and application security updates and patches to remediate vulnerabilities in collaboration with IT, compliance, and vulnerability management teams

  • Designs, implements, and manages security controls to protect against unauthorized access, data loss, and other security threats against the firm’s on-prem infrastructure and cloud-based platforms

  • Monitors system performance, troubleshoots complex issues, and ensures high availability of servers, appliances, and applications

  • Provides Tier 3 technical support, root cause analysis, and guidance for IT infrastructure, application, and security operations tasks

  • Secures and governs Microsoft Entra ID and Azure tenants, applying best practices for cloud security and governance

  • Identifies opportunities for automation to improve system reliability and reduce manual effort

  • Develops and maintains automation and scripting solutions to automate administrative, security-related, and routine tasks and reporting to improve efficiency and reduce operational overhead

  • Leverages APIs for integration, automation, and enhancement of monitoring and management across systems and tools

  • Leads IT infrastructure projects, migrations, upgrades, and new technology initiatives in collaboration with cross-functional teams and external partners

  • Drives major technology initiatives such as new technologies and solutions, upgrades, migrations, and integrations, recommending improvements to existing systems and processes

  • Develops and maintain disaster recovery strategies, documentation, and testing procedures

  • Maintains up-to-date knowledge of emerging trends and best practices in infrastructure modernization, security, monitoring, cloud platforms, and AI model infrastructure security
